Crafting the Culinary Masterpiece: A Step-by-Step Guide
The creation of this dish involves three distinct but complementary components: the roasted walnuts, the crispy gnocchi mixture, and the Muhammara bean dip, all brought together with a flavorful crumble.
1. Roasting the Walnuts: Building the Foundation of Flavor
The process begins with toasting the walnuts, a simple step that unlocks their rich, nutty aroma and flavor.
- Method: Add walnuts to a small skillet over medium-low heat. Toast for approximately 3 to 5 minutes, stirring frequently, until they emit a nutty fragrance. Be mindful of the residual heat, as the walnuts will continue to roast slightly after the heat is turned off. This aromatic foundation is crucial for both the dip and the crumble topping.
2. Preparing the Crispy Gnocchi and Vegetable Medley
This stage focuses on achieving the desired crispy texture for the gnocchi and vegetables.
- Preheating: Preheat your oven to 410°F (210°C).
- Coating: Lightly oil a baking sheet. In a bowl, toss the gnocchi, beans, and cauliflower florets with a bit of oil. Ensure everything is evenly coated.
- Spice Infusion: In a separate small bowl, combine all the spices designated for the crispy gnocchi. Sprinkle this aromatic blend over the gnocchi and vegetable mixture. Toss thoroughly to ensure an even distribution of spices and oil.
- Even Layering: Spread the coated gnocchi and vegetables in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et. Avoid overcrowding to promote even crisping.
- Baking: Bake for 15 to 17 minutes. At this point, check the gnocchi and cauliflower. Gently toss them with a spatula to encourage uniform browning. For larger cauliflower florets, consider placing them towards the edges of the pan for enhanced caramelization. Continue baking for an additional 5 to 10 minutes, or until the gnocchi are crisp on the outside, the beans are slightly crunchy, and the cauliflower is cooked to your preference. Vigilance is key here, as over-baking can result in hard gnocchi. Once perfectly cooked, remove from the oven and set aside.
3. Crafting the Flavorful Components: Muhammara Dip and Walnut Crumble

While the gnocchi bakes, the vibrant Muhammara dip and the zesty walnut crumble are prepared.

Muhammara Bean Dip:
- Walnut Preparation: Reserve approximately 2 tablespoons of the roasted walnuts for the crumble. Place the remaining walnuts into a food processor and process until they form a coarse meal. Add a clove of garlic and process again to finely chop the garlic.
- Incorporating Ingredients: Add the roasted red bell pepper, beans, Middle Eastern spice blend (such as baharat or shawarma spice), olive oil, lemon juice, and pomegranate molasses to the food processor.
- Processing: Process the mixture until it achieves a relatively smooth consistency, while still retaining some texture from the walnuts.
- Seasoning: Taste and adjust the seasoning as needed. Add more salt, lemon juice, heat (if desired), or spices to achieve your preferred flavor balance. Set the dip aside.
-
Walnut Lemon Crumble:
- Chopping Walnuts: Finely chop the reserved 2 tablespoons of roasted walnuts.
- Adding Flavor: Mix in the lemon zest, salt, and red pepper flakes. Set this flavorful crumble aside for garnishing.
4. The Grand Finale: Assembling and Serving
The final step is to bring all the elements together for a visually appealing and delicious presentation.
-
Platter Presentation: Spread the Muhammara bean dip generously onto a serving plate. Arrange the crispy gnocchi, cauliflower, and roasted beans on top. Sprinkle the walnut lemon crumble over the assembled dish. Garnish with fresh chopped herbs and serve with lemon slices or a squeeze of fresh lemon juice.
-
Creamy Gnocchi Salad: In a bowl, combine the crispy gnocchi mixture with chopped vegetables such as onion, red bell pepper, cucumber, or tomato. Add a generous portion of the Muhammara bean dip and a few teaspoons of lemon juice. Toss well to coat all the ingredients. For a creamier texture, stir in 2 to 3 tablespoons of non-dairy yogurt. Adjust seasoning to taste and serve immediately.

Variations and Dietary Considerations
The recipe is inherently adaptable, catering to various dietary needs and preferences.
- Gluten-Free: For a gluten-free version, ensure you use gluten-free gnocchi. Alternatively, the recipe notes suggest using more beans as a substitute if gluten-free gnocchi is unavailable.
- Soy-Free: The recipe is naturally soy-free, making it a safe and delicious option for those avoiding soy.
- Spice Blends: The creator notes that while Baharat or Shawarma spice blends are recommended for their Middle Eastern authenticity, other blends like harissa or garam masala can be used, allowing for a personalized flavor profile.
